To me SIGN comes off as "Oversteps 0.5"
Sure, it's a gorgeous opening, a fantastic closer, a few
decent tracks in between, but frankly I feel more bored than
challenged by this album. The overindulgence in endless,
sloppy chord progressions leaves me rather underwhelmed. I
dont think that has ever happened to me with a brand new Ae
album before. Oversteps - never among my favorite Autechre
albums - is better than this, imho. Oh well. I've heard
rumours of a second new album to be released shortly, so I'm
not complaining.
